Pinpoint Test H: The Puddle Lamps Stay On Continuously

Refer to Wiring Diagram Set 89, Interior Lamps for schematic and connector information. Diagrams By Number

Normal Operation

The Smart Junction Box (SJB) provides voltage to the puddle lamps through circuit CLN25 (VT). The puddle lamps have separate ground circuits. The LH exterior mirror is grounded through circuit GD133 (BK), and the RH exterior mirror is grounded through circuit GD148 (BK/YE).

- DTC B2A39 (Puddle Lamp Output Circuit Open) - an on-demand DTC that sets when the SJB detects a short to voltage on the puddle lamp output circuit.

This pinpoint test is intended to diagnose the following:
- Wiring, terminals or connectors
- SJB



PINPOINT TEST H: THE PUDDLE LAMPS STAY ON CONTINUOUSLY

-------------------------------------------------
H1 CHECK CIRCUIT CLN25 (VT) FOR A SHORT TO VOLTAGE


- Ignition OFF.
- Disconnect: SJB C2280c.
- Ignition ON.
- Do the puddle lamps continue to illuminate?

Yes
REPAIR the circuit.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the self-test.

No
GO to H2.

-------------------------------------------------
H2 CHECK FOR CORRECT SJB OPERATION


- Disconnect all the SJB connectors.
- Check for:
- corrosion
- damaged pins
- pushed-out pins
- Connect all the SJB connectors and make sure they seat correctly.
- Operate the system and verify the concern is still present.
- Is the concern still present?

Yes
INSTALL a new SJB. TEST the system for normal operation.

No
The system is operating correctly at this time. The concern may have been caused by a loose or corroded connector.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the self-test.
